I traded with Ronw this past week for a 58" 43@28 JK Traditions Kanati. I knew from the first shot that it was going to be a keeper. Looks like it might just have a little mojo going on too!   :p

Just about didn't go out tonight. Been working on a deck extension in the back of the house and it was still 90 degrees at 6 pm.  
Finally got the gumption up to go out about 6:30 and about 7 had a group of young pigs show up. Drew back and let her fly. The 125 grain snuffer hit right where I was looking and buried to the fletching. All the pigs ran off but the ones that hadn't been poked came back in pretty quickly. I ALMOST took another shot but figured with it as hot as it was I'd have enough on my hands getting the first one in the cooler. The one I shot made it about 20 yards and when he let out his last squeal, the others figured something was up and took off.
Thanks Ronw for a definite keeper of a bow!
